Transaction 5397889a1c9d37908eafaca7529af2e5b5e85fc31e2122355c93345fbb963a3f
1 Input
1 Output
-
5397889a1c9d37908eafaca7529af2e5b5e85fc31e2122355c93345fbb963a3f:0
- value
- 2825630
- script pubkey
- OP_0 OP_PUSHBYTES_20 1b23cb280c62a9e0a91307fb23c492e2ed674b61
- address
- bc1qrv3uk2qvv257p2gnqlaj83yjutkkwjmpvawspa